This is a Phase 1 drug–drug interaction pharmacokinetic study examining how AZD6234, AZD9550, and their combination affect oral contraceptive exposure in healthy women with overweight or obesity. No results are yet available in this registry record; the study is still recruiting and designed to measure plasma concentrations and derived PK parameters across multiple sampling intervals.
Phase 1, Interventional, Non Randomized, Sequential, Open label, Treatment purpose. Healthy Participants; Female; age from 35 Years; to 75 Years; accepts healthy volunteers. Intervention: Cohort-1: AZD6234 + EE/LEVO + Acetaminophen (APAP); Cohort-2: AZD6234+AZD9550+EE/LEVO+APAP; Cohort-3: AZD9550 + EE/LEVO + APAP; Cohort-4: AZD6234+AZD9550+EE/LEVO+APAP. Compared with: Combined oral contraceptive ethinyl estradiol/levonorgestrel alone (baseline/predose). n = 50. 2 sites: United States.

Registry record from ClinicalTrials.gov (NCT07013643). This is a study registration, not published results. Lead sponsor: AstraZeneca. Recruitment status: RECRUITING. Phase: PHASE1. Study type: INTERVENTIONAL. Enrollment: 50 participants (ESTIMATED). Conditions: Healthy Participants. Interventions: DRUG: AZD6234; DRUG: Ethinyl estradiol/Levonorgestrel (EE/LEVO); DRUG: Acetaminophen (APAP); DRUG: AZD9550. Primary outcome measures: Area under the concentration-time curve from time 0 to infinity (AUCinf) of EE and LEVO , Cohort 1: At predefined intervals from Day -5 up to Day 99; Cohort 2 : At pre-defined interval from Day -5 up to Day 169; Cohort 3: At predefined intervals from Day -5 up to Day 225; Cohort 4: At predefined intervals from Day -5 up to Day 253; Area under the concentration-time curve from time of dosing to the last measurable concentration (AUClast) of EE and LEVO , Cohort 1: At predefined intervals from Day -5 up to Day 99; Cohort 2 : At pre-defined interval from Day -5 up to Day 169; Cohort 3: At predefined intervals from Day -5 up to Day 225; Cohort 4: At predefined intervals from Day -5 up to Day 253; Maximum plasma concentration (Cmax) of EE and LEVO , Cohort 1: At predefined intervals from Day -5 up to Day 99; Cohort 2 : At pre-defined interval from Day -5 up to Day 169; Cohort 3: At predefined intervals from Day -5 up to Day 225; Cohort 4: At predefined intervals from Day -5 up to Day 253; Time to reach maximum drug concentration in plasma (tmax) of EE and LEVO , Cohort 1: At predefined intervals from Day -5 up to Day 99; Cohort 2 : At pre-defined interval from Day -5 up to Day 169; Cohort 3: At predefined intervals from Day -5 up to Day 225; Cohort 4: At predefined intervals from Day -5 up to Day 253; Elimination half-life (t1/2λz) of EE and LEVO , Cohort 1: At predefined intervals from Day -5 up to Day 99; Cohort 2 : At pre-defined interval from Day -5 up to Day 169; Cohort 3: At predefined intervals from Day -5 up to Day 225; Cohort 4: At predefined intervals from Day -5 up to Day 253. Brief summary: This study will measure the effects of multiple doses of AZD6234, AZD9550 and a combination of AZD9550 and AZD6234 given as injection(s) on pharmacokinetics (PK) of combined oral contraceptive (CoC) ethinyl estradiol (EE)/levonorgestrel (LEVO) in healthy female participants with obesity.
